I initially left a very positive review of Dumpling Haus two years ago shortly after I was diagnosed. At the time, they were the only restaurant I had successfully ordered gluten free meals from. Although they are an Asian restaurant, they do not use soy sauce in their dishes, which is a major source of gluten in Asian cuisine. I mostly ordered delivery, and the folks I spoke with on the phone were always happy to answer questions and seemed to have a thorough understanding of celiac-safe gluten free food.
I stopped getting food from Dumpling Haus for a while, not because of anything particular, but just because I was trying to eat healthier. However, I went in a few weeks ago for the first time in a year and a half, and things have changed for the worse. The woman at the register was very impatient and did not seem to understand my questions about cross-contact/cross-contamination. She just kept repeating “It’s gluten free.” To be clear, there was no line behind me, so I wasn’t holding anyone up. Even though I felt uncomfortable, I placed an order for shrimp fried rice and then watched the folks in the kitchen. I do not know for sure if they have designated utensils for gluten free items, but it didn’t look like it. They do not wear gloves, let alone change them before touching different dishes. I ended up tossing my food in the garbage without eating it. I do not plan to go back anytime soon.

Do not eat here if you have celiac disease or a serious gluten sensitivity. I was assured I was eating gluten free noodles, but they were not. I realized a few bites in, got terribly ill within two hours, and have been unwell for weeks since.
The restaurant responded to my Google review three weeks later saying I was not clear I had an allergy. This is untrue. I was very clear I had celiac disease and an allergy to gluten. I am always extremely clear whenever I eat at restaurants and have never had a similar issue. This incident has had a very severe impact on my health. I have since been ill for more than four weeks, requiring multiple medical tests in Chicago and the UK over the holidays.
